ARBOLES BINARIOS

Description

ARBOL
karen cg
Flashcards by karen cg, updated more than 1 year ago
karen cg
Created by karen cg about 8 years ago
320
0

Resource summary

Question Answer
DEFINICION DE ARBOL Es una estructura de datos en la cual cada nodo puede tener un hijo izquierdo y un hijo derecho. No pueden tener más de dos hijos . Si algún hijo tiene como referencia a null, es decir que no almacena ningún dato, entonces este es llamado un nodo externo. En el caso contrario el hijo es llamado un nodo interno.
CLASIFICACION DE ARBOLES * Distinto. * Similares. * Equivalentes. * Completos.
EJEMPLO DE ARBOL BINARIO,EQUIVALENTE,COMPLEJO * Distinto:Se dice que dos árboles binarios son distintos cuando sus estructuras son diferentes. * Similares:Dos arboles binarios son similares cuando sus estructuras son idénticas, pero la información que contienen sus nodos es diferente * Equivalentes:Son aquellos arboles que son similares y que además los nodos contienen la misma información. * Completos:Son aquellos arboles en los que todos sus nodos excepto los del ultimo nivel, tiene dos hijos; el subárbol izquierdo y el subárbol derecho.
COMO SE REPRESENTA UN ARBOL BINARIO EN MEMORIA Por medio de datos tipo puntero conocidos como variable dinámica Por medio de ciclos Los datos del árbol binario se representan como registros que como mínimo contiene 3 campos.
MENCIONA LOS ALGORITMOS PARA REALIZAR LOS RECORRIDOS Hay tres manera de recorrer un árbol : en inorden, preorden y postorden. Cada una de ellas tiene una secuencia distinta para analizar el árbol como se puede ver a continuación: INORDEN Recorrer el subárbol izquierdo en inorden. Examinar la raíz. Recorrer el subárbol derecho en inorden. PREORDEN Examinar la raíz. Recorrer el subárbol izquierdo en preorden. recorrer el subárbol derecho en preorden. POSTORDEN Recorrer el subárbol izquierdo en postorden. Recorrer el subárbol derecho en postorden.Examinar la raíz.
CUÁLES SON LAS PRINCIPALES OPERACIONES QUE SE PUEDEN REALIZAR SOBRE UN ÁRBOL BINARIO -inserción –eliminación
EN QUE CONSISTE EL PROCESO DE INSERCIÓN (PRESENTA EL ALGORITMO) El procedimiento de inserción en un árbol binario de búsqueda es muy sencillo, únicamente hay que tener cuidado de no romper la estructura ni el orden del árbol. Cuando se inserta un nuevo nodo en el árbol hay que tener en cuenta que cada nodo no puede tener más de dos hijos, por esta razón si un nodo ya tiene 2 hijos, el nuevo nodo nunca se podrá́ insertar como su hijo. Con esta restricción nos aseguramos mantener la estructura del árbol, pero aun nos falta mantener el orden.
QUE OTRAS OPERACIONES SE PUEDEN REALIZAR RECURSIVANE TE EN LOES ARBOLES BINARIOS El algoritmo compara el elemento a buscar con la raíz, si es menor continua la búsqueda por la rama izquierda, si es mayor continua por la izquierda. Este procedimiento se realiza recursivamente hasta que se encuentra el nodo o hasta que se llega al final del árbol.
Show full summary Hide full summary

Similar

Mapa Conceptual de la arquitectura de base de datos
Alan Alvarado
Abreviaciones comunes en programación web
Diego Santos
codigos QR
Cristina Padilla
ANALISIS SISTEMATICO DE LA COMPUTADORA Y LOS PERIFERICOS QUE LO INTEGRAN
Ana pinzon
Simbología de programacion
Gustavo Angel Beristain Vazquez
Historia de la Computadora
Diego Santos
BASES DE DATOS
Horst Berndt Reyes
Programación orientada a objetos (POO).
Lina Melo
Latex
Maye Tapia
Test PYTHON
peralesmagana
Ejercicio tipos de Software
Marco. G